Printing of the 3,500 copies was done by Josten 's Printing and Publishing Division of Visalia, California. Richard Tristao served as our inplant consultant and Dean Bawcom of Searcy served as our representative. Paste-ups were done by Josten 's, who also set most of the type. The index was typeset by the Harding Press. The theme and division page design were conceived by Jennifer R. Terry; cover designed by Phillip Tucker and Jennifer R. Terry on a napkin in TCBY. The cover was a caftline embossed leat her tone in Basin #51 7 with Cordova grain and raised lettering and artwork. Applied colors were Silver Foil #381 and Blue-Green #343. Endsheets were Silver Sterling #420 paper stock with Medium Blue #285 the applied color. The book consisted of 332 pages of 80 lbs. high gloss enamel stock, 9"x12". Color pages used Pantone Paper in varying shades and colors. Most headlines were typeset by J osten 's, with a few set using the Apple Macintosh and LaserWriter. Text ranged from 6 point Century Schoolbook and in 8 point century schoolbook bold. Drop letters were in 36 point Century Schoolbook. Most photographs were student taken and printed in the Petit Jean darkroom. Nearly 200 rolls of black and whi te film were processed. Color photographs were printed by Magna IV in Little Rock. Portraits were taken by John Baker Photography in Searcy. The Petit Jean office is locat ed in the Myra Lou Tyer suite on the second floor of the Hammon Student Center. Address any correspondence to Box 812, Station A, Searcy, AR 72143. The office can be reached by phone at (501) 279-4275. The cost for a Petit Jean was included in student registration fees and t otaled $18 for the year.
